Rochester, MN (KROC AM News) - A man who exposed himself to a young girl at a Rochester park has been identified and a warrant has been issued for his arrest.

The incident happened in May at a small playground along the Zumbro River near the former Roscoe’s site.

A Rochester man was there with his 3-year-old daughter and 1-year-old son. He told police he was tending to his son while his daughter was on a teeter-totter. A man suddenly appeared and joined the girl on the teeter-totter and later began pushing her on a swing.

The father told police he felt uncomfortable about the man and decided to leave. The father told police “when he told his daughter it was time to go home for lunch” the suspect suddenly dropped his pants and began fondling himself.  When the father yelled at the man, he pulled up his pants and walked away.

An RPD investigator assigned to the case was able to link the description of the suspect to an earlier incident and a positive ID was made.

The man being sought has been identified as 37-year-old Seth Sorem, who is described as homeless. He has been charged with 5th-degree criminal sexual conduct and indecent exposure.
